Cables are the lifelines of progress, and at ENGINEER & MARVEX 2025, three Malaysian champions, Southern Cable, Master Tec, and Smart Cable, are proving that the future is wired for progress.
Southern Cable is setting the industry’s pace with solutions spanning power, data, automotive, renewable energy, and industrial needs. Backed by its R&D-focused Southern Lab, the company prides itself on quality and safety.
“We, Southern Cable, design with specification and manufacture with integrity,” said John Lim, Marketing and Country General Manager. If you want to see how cables can shape entire industries, this is the booth to watch.
Master Tec has over a decade of experience and three plants in Melaka – and it’s showing up strong with IOS-certified low-voltage, fire-rated, renewable, and industrial cables.
“Master Tec is one of the local companies that is expanding into the latest trends, and is also actively supplying to data centres,” said Ts. Nazroel Mokhtar, the company’s Chief Business Development Officer.
Meanwhile, Smart Cable is redefining industry leadership with its solar cable, designed in black and red for durability and efficiency. But innovation is only one part of its DNA, the company also champions social responsibility, with the various CSR projects being displayed at their booth, echoing the guiding principles of smart giving, bright future.
“ENGINEER & MARVEX have given us brand awareness for the past few years; we are excited to continue being a part of this exhibition and also to showcase our product while also highlighting the importance of society welfare,” said Celine Low, Corporate Communication Specialist.
Together, these companies represent the pulse of Malaysia’s cabling industry, powering economies, enabling sustainability, and building the invisible networks that secure our future.
